Published by The Independent, October 13, 2022
Headline: Renowned NYC Musician Dies By Assisted Suicide in Switzerland After Having “Completed Life.”

A renowned genre-bending drummer who played with musicians from Michael Stipe to Herbie Hancock died by assisted suicide in Switzerland after having “completed life.”
Anton Fier, 66, travelled to Basel, Switzerland, where he died by assisted suicide at the Pegasos clinic on 14 September, according to a cremation notice.
Exit International director Philip Nitschke told The Independent that Fier was not suffering from terminal illness, but wanted to die on his own terms after feeling he had accomplished everyth...

Pat Joyce looked a bit like Santa Claus in recent years, and seeing him arrive in his truck, for people stranded on the roadside, was probably better than the thought of seeing Santa in his sleigh.

CLEVELAND, Ohio -- Pat Joyce liked hunting and he liked classic cars, but he rarely had any time for that.

He was a small business owner and a tow truck operator. And what he had time for was work.

"Pat always towed. He towed on Christmas Day. He towed 24 hours a day, year round," said Tim Huston, who drove a wrecker for Joyce's Euclid towing concern, Professional Automotive Tow...
